Workshop on Good Clinical Practice held

Shillong: A one-day workshop on Good Clinical Practice was conducted in NEIGRIHMS on August 14. The aim of the workshop was to improve the understanding bioethical issues related to biomedical research and Clinical trial. The workshop will pave a way for Ethics Committee of NEIGRIHMS to get registration with Drug Controller General of India. 164 participants from different parts of country participated in the workshop. The resource persons Dr. S.Sandiya ,Dr. Melvin George and Dr. Sanish Davis spoke about principles of Good Clinical Practice, Regulations and guidelines in India for Clinical trials, Audits, inspection and monitoring in clinical trials, essential documents among other topics.
